Transaction 5930043b16de23cd85eb9e43ee4f3393b752cd7e8454c135267d125f91f948b3

1 Input
2 Outputs
  • 5930043b16de23cd85eb9e43ee4f3393b752cd7e8454c135267d125f91f948b3:0
  • value  37005172
    address  3F2cEaeFkjFX9TebP9HD8Xvmddx6u1Pmge
  • 5930043b16de23cd85eb9e43ee4f3393b752cd7e8454c135267d125f91f948b3:1
  • value  2450000
    address  18Bk7vJRRxVvhAuQBgyTt45epXiPmKek7b